Step-by-step
Follow these steps
- 1
Install the RecordMeeting extension
Install the RecordMeeting Chrome extension from the Chrome Web Store. Sign in with your Google account when prompted. It's free to start and no credit card is required.
- 2
Record your Teams meeting
Join the Teams call in your browser and click the RecordMeeting button to start recording. No bot joins the call.
- 3
Wait for the transcript to process
When you leave the call, the recording uploads and the transcript is generated automatically with OpenAI Whisper. Most meetings are ready within a few minutes.
- 4
Read, search, or export the transcript
Open the meeting in your workspace to read the full transcript with timestamps and speaker labels. Search inside it, copy text, or download as TXT, DOCX, or SRT subtitles.
- 5
Use the AI summary
Alongside the transcript, RecordMeeting generates a summary, key topics, and an action-items list, useful for sharing meeting outcomes without making your team re-watch the call.
